I have a 3Com Home Click LAN setup at home (2 computers) and a calbe modem access. However, I cannot seem to get them BOTH to work. How can I set up the system so the modem comes into the hub, then to the computers, yet still have full-speed LAN file and print sharing?

well if you want to do it that way, you have to purchase another ip from your cable service, so you can have 2 ip's, just put the cat5 cable, of your cable modem into the uplink port, and both of your computers are suppose to have a nic each, and get a cat5 cable and stick the other end to the hub, do that with both computers, what operating system(s) do you have?

well the equpiment that you need is 2 cat5 cables(excluding the cat5 cable of your cable modem), 2 network cards, 2 ip addresses, a 4 port hub or higher , a cable modem so you can connect that to you hub, and an operating system

I'd get a router or convert an existing system into a server before I'd purchase another IP.
